CentSO7.6下部署Maridb Galera Cluster 實踐記錄(二)

           早上三個節點的數據庫都啓動正常,下午上班就都不行了,哎,VM啊,中午就是讓主機休息了一些而已麼。

            今天繼續折騰中,第二天再來一遍:重啓第一臺服務器上的galera時竟然報錯了:錯誤如下:

         It may not be safe to bootstrap the cluster from this node. It was not the last one to leave the cluster and may not contain all the updates. To force cluster bootstrap with this node, edit the grastate.dat file manually and set safe_to_bootstrap to 1 .

         大概意思是這臺服務器不是最後一個關閉的,需要修改grastate.dat文件中的safe_to_bootstrap的值爲1,意思很明白,但是這個文件在那塊不知道,度娘了下才曉得在這個位置:/var/lib/mysql/grastate.dat,我試試看

   

      確實如此,修改下對應的參數。保存,卻還是沒有啓動成功,嘗試修改了幾次其值還是沒有變過來,看來得重啓下服務器試試。

     可以看到重啓後成功了,看來必須得把之前的那個服務給停掉,否則修改是不會成功的。現在則可以成功啓動了

        接下來繼續填坑,莫名的報此錯誤:

       我是百度又度娘,各種折騰還是不行,乾脆卸載了再重新安裝試試:

       # yum remove mariadb

      # rpm -qa|grep mariadb

      # rm -rf /var/lib/mysql/

      # yum install -y mariadb-server

     # systemctl start mariadb

     測試目前沒加galera時,可以正常啓動成功,停止服務後修改配置文件後繼續啓動服務,試試:

       繼續狗血,現在又報這個錯誤,按照網上說的啓動時加個參數:--wsrep-new-cluster

      再試試:

   還是不行啊,奇怪的。看提示信息及網上提醒:需要在配置文件裏面增加一個集羣名稱,分別又再其他幾臺服務器上進行修改並重啓相應的服務;

   現在再重啓當前的服務器的服務試試:結果成功了。誰能告訴我這是怎麼回事呢?

      同時也很欣喜,看到新增的數據庫及相應的數據了。

      哎,另外一臺還是不行,還得繼續折騰啊。

 

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章